AWS Cloud Migration: Steps You Can't Afford to Skip

Migrating to the AWS Cloud is more than just moving data and applications — it’s about transforming how your business operates, scales, and innovates. However, successful migration doesn’t happen by chance. It requires careful planning, the right strategy, and flawless execution at every stage. In this section, we’ll walk you through the essential steps you can’t afford to skip during your AWS cloud migration journey — from initial assessment to optimization — to ensure a smooth, secure, and cost-efficient transition.

Listed below are the key steps;

  • Planning and assessment: The emphasis when you kick off the migration process is on developing a business case and determining the scope of the migration. Start with scanning the on-premises IT environment to create a comprehensive inventory. This discovery and inventory process is critical for mapping application dependencies as well as determining current resource utilization patterns. After the inventory, each app is evaluated against established migration strategies to determine the most effective technical path forward.
  • Infrastructure set up: Now it's time to secure the target destination in the AWS cloud so it can host the migrated workloads. The foundation is laid by configuring the AWS Landing Zone, which ensures necessary governance, security, etc. across various environments such as Development and Production. Then you set up the requisite network configurations as well as secure, high-bandwidth connectivity between the on-premises data center and AWS. I don't have to tell you just how important security. So, you will also be configuring AWS Identity and Access Management (IAM) policies to enforce the principle of least privilege and establishing foundational security.
  • Migration: It is now time to move the identified workloads and data to the newly configured AWS environment. Data migration frequently occurs before application cutover. For databases, AWS Database Migration Service (DMS) is commonly used to manage both the full initial data load and continuous replication of changes. Whereas large amounts of file and block storage are transferred using appropriate services such as AWS DataSync or the AWS Snow Family. Small pilot migrations at this stage help rigorously test to ensure the process works as expected.
  • Validating migration: It is time for your organization to see to it that the migrated workloads are operational and meet all requirements in the new AWS environment. Functional testing is performed immediately following migration to ensure that the application's core capabilities, including user interface and business logic, work exactly as they did on premises. This is followed by performance and stress testing, which consists of simulating expected and peak user traffic loads. This is to help you ensure that the app scales correctly and maintains specified response times without degradation. Security and compliance validation is a non-negotiable step that verifies IAM roles, regulatory standards, etc.
  • Post migration performance optimization: The final stage marks the start of the cloud operational lifecycle, with a focus on continuous improvement to fully reap the benefits of migration. Cost optimization is, of course, a major focus. Technical teams work on performance tuning, i.e., making additional configuration changes to increase the efficiency of AWS services. This ongoing refinement process ensures that the organization's cloud presence remains secure and high-performing over time.
